SUMMARY
At the request of Elf Atochem S.A., Paris-la-Defense, France, the potential of the test substance according to O.E.C.D. (No. 404, 17th July 1992) and E.C. (92/69/E.E.C., 84, 31st July 1992)
guidelines. The study was conducted in compliance with the Principles of Good Laboratory Practice Regulations.
Methods
The study design was established according to available information on the test substance and the above guidelines.
The test substance was applied for 4 hours to three male New Zealand White rabbits.
A single dose of 0.5 ml of the test substance in its original form was applied to the closelyclipped skin of the flank.
The test substance was held in contact with the skin by means of a semi-occlusive dressing. Cutaneous reactions were observed approximately one hour, 24, 48 and 72 hours after removal of the dressing.
The mean values of the scores for erythema and oedema were calculated for each animal.
Results
Very slight or well-defined erythema was noted in all animals at the 1-hour reading. It persisted for 24 hours in one animal, and for 48 hours in the two other animals. No oedema was observed.
Mean scores over 24, 48 and 72 hours for individual animal were 0.3, 1.0 and 0.7 for erythema and 0.0 for oedema.
Conclusion
Under our experimental conditions, the test substance^
was
considered non-irritant when administered by cutaneous route in rabbits.

1. INTRODUCTION
The objective of this study was to evaluate the potential of the test substance to induce dermal irritation following a single administration in rabbits.
In the assessment of the toxic characteristics of a test substance, determination of the irritant and/or corrosive effects on the skin of mammals is an important initial step.
Information derived from this test serves to indicate the possible existence of hazards to Man likely to arise from cutaneous exposure to the test substance.
This study was conducted in compliance with: . O.E.C.D. guideline No. 404,17th July 1992.
. E.C. Directive No. 92/69/E.E.C., By 31st July 1992.

2.2. TEST SYSTEM
2.2.1 Animals Sex, species, strain: male New Zealand White rabbits. Reason for this choice: species commonly requested by the international regulations for this type of study. Breeder: Elevage Cunicole de Val de Selle, 80160 Prouzel, France. Number of animals and identification: three animals were used, as recommended by the international regulations and taking into account that a good correlation of results can be obtained with either three or six animals (i). The animals were identified individually with a metal tag in the ear. Weight: on the day of treatment, the animals had a mean body weight standard deviation of 2.2 0.2 kg. Acclimatization: at least five days before the beginning of the study.
2.2.2 Environmental conditions During the acclimatization period and during the main test, the environmental conditions in the animal room were set as follows:
. temperature: 183C
. relative humidity: 30 to 70% . light/dark cycle: 12 h/12 h . ventilation: approximately 12 cycles/hour of filtered, non-recycled air. The temperature and relative humidity were recorded continuously and records retained. The housing conditions (temperature, relative humidity and ventilation) were checked monthly. The animals were housed individually in polystyrene cages (35 cm x 55 cm x 32 cm or 48.2 cm x 58 cm x 36.5 cm). Each cage was equipped with a food container and a water bottle.
2.2.3 Food and water All the animals had free access to 112 C pelleted diet (U.A.R., 91360 Villemoisson-sur-Orge, France). Each batch of food was analysed (composition and contaminants) by the supplier. The diet formula is presented in appendix 2.
Drinking water filtered by a F.G. Millipore membrane (0.22 micron) was provided adiibitimi. Bacteriological and chemical analysis of the water and diet and detection of possible contaminants (pesticides, heavy metals and nitrosamines) are performed periodically. Results are archived at C.I.T.
It was verifred that no contaminants in the diet'or water at levels likely to influence the outcome of the study were present.
(l)Hatoum, N.S.;'Leach, C.L; Talsma, D.M-; Gibbons, R.D.; Garvin, P.J.:'A statistical basis for using fewer Rabbits in dermal irritation testing. Journal of the American College
of Toxicology. 9: 49-60 (1990).

2.3. TREATMENT
2.3.1 Preparation and selection of the animals The day before treatment, the flanks of each animal were clipped using electric clippers. The skin of each animal was examined in order to use only animals without any signs of cutaneous irritation. Animals showing signs of cutaneous irritation, cutaneous defects or pre-existing dermal injury were not used.
2.3.2 Study design The study design was established according to available information on the test substance and following the O.E.C.D. and E.C. guidelines.
As no irritant effects were anticipated, the test substance was applied for 4 hours to three animals.
2.3.3 Application of the test substance The test substance was used in its original form.
A single dose of 0.5 ml of the test substance was prepared on a 6 cm2 dry gauze pad (Cooperative Pharmaceutique Francaise, 77000 Melun, France) which was then applied to the right flank of the animals for 4 hours.
The test substance and the gauze pad were held in contact with the skin by means of an adhesive hypoallergenic aerated semi-occlusive dressing (Laboratoires de Pansements et d'Hygiene, 21300 Chenove, France) and a restraining bandage (Laboratoires 3M Sante, 92245 Malakoff,
France).
The untreated skin served as control.
No residual test substance was noted at removal of the dressing. 2.3.4 Date of treatment

2.4. CUTANEOUS EXAMINATIONS
The skin was examined approximately one hour, 24, 48 and 72 hours after removal of the dressing.
Following the O.E.C.D. and E.C. guidelines: . when there is no evidence of dermal irritation after 72 hours, the study is ended. . when there is persistent cutaneous irritation after 72 hours, the observation period is extended
to a maximum of 14 days (until day 15) in order to determine the progress of the lesions and their reversibility. . when severe irritant effects are observed, the animals are killed on humane ground.
Any change in the animals' behaviour was noted.
2.5. DESCRIPTION AND EVALUATION OF CUTANEOUS REACTIONS
Dermal irritation was evaluated for each animal according to the following scoring scale:
Erythema and eschar formation:
. no erythema.........................................................................................................
0
. very slight erythema (barely perceptible) ..........................................'.................
1
. well-defined erythema .......................................................................................
2
. moderate to severe erythema .............................................................................
3
. severe erythema (beet redness) to slight eschar formation (injuries in depth) ...
4
Oedema formation
. no oedema .........................................................................................................
0
. very slight oedema (barely perceptible)..........;...................................................
1
. slight oedema (edges of area well-defined by definite raising) .........................
2
. moderate oedema (raised approximately 1 millimetre) ......................................
3
. severe oedema (raised more than 1 millimetre and extending beyond area
of exposure) .......................................................................................................
4
Any other lesions were noted.

2.6.
INTERPRETATION OF RESULTS AND CLASSIFICATION OF SUBSTANCES
The results obtained were evaluated taking into consideration the nature and the reversibility of
i
the findings observed.
2.6.1 Interpretation of the results
2.6.1.1 Criteria for irritation
A substance or a preparation is considered to be irritating to skin if, when it is applied to healthy intact animal skin for up to 4 hours, significant inflammation is caused and which pcrs-ists for 24 hours or more after the end of the exposure period.

2.6.1.2 Criteria for corrosion
A substance or a preparation is considered to be corrosive if, when it is applied to healthy intact animal skin, it produces full thickness destruction of skin tissue on at least one animal during
the test for skin irritation, or if the result can be predicted, for example: from strongly acid or
alkaline reactions.
2.6.2 Classification of the test substance
2.6.2.1 Irritant substances - symbol Xi: indication of danger: "irritant",
- phrase indicating the nature of special risks:
R 38: "Irritating to skin"
Inflammation is significant if:
. the mean value of the scores is two or more for either erythema and eschar formation or oedema formation. The same will be the case where the test has been completed using three animals if the score for either erythema and eschar formation or oedema formation observed in two or more animals is equivalent to the value of two or more,
. it persists in at least two animals at the end of the observation period. Specific effects such as hyperplasia, desquamation, discolouration, fisures, eschar and alopecia should be taken into
account.
All scores obtained at each reading time (24, 48 and 72 hours) for an effect are used by calculating the respective mean values.
2.6.2.2 Corrosive substances - symbol C: indication of danger: "corrosive",
- phrases indicating the nature of special risks:
R 34: "Causes burns" If, when applied to healthy intact animal skin, full thickness destruction of
tissue occurs as a result of up to 4 hours exposure, or if this result can be predicted.
skin
R 35: "Causes severe burns"
If, when applied to healthy intact animal skin, full thickness destruction of skin tissue' occurs as a result of up to 3 minutes exposure, or if this result can be predicted.

3. RESULTS (table 1) Very slight or well-defined erythema (grade 1 or 2) was noted in all animals at the 1-hour reading. It persisted for 24 hours in one animal, and for 48 hours in the two other animals. No
oedema was observed. Mean scores over 24, 48 and 72 hours for individual animal were 0.3, 1.0 and 0.7 for erythema and 0.0 for oedema.
4. CONCLUSION Under our experimental conditions, the test substance FORAFAC 1203 (batch No. 25-28) was
considered non-irritant when administered by cutaneous route in rabbits.
